May, 1975 writer Len Wein and artsist Dave Cockrum created a mutant who would become one of the most famous of all Xmen...he is:


NIGHTCRAWLER.

He has the mutant abilities of Teleportation, night vision (enhanced), superhuman acrobatics and agility, as well as the abilities to blend with shadows and stick to walls. He has also had training for fencing and martical arts. HIs skin is blue, he has a tail, and two toes and three fingers.

His real name is Kurt Wagner: a German Catholic *later inhis days alot more vocal about his faith* who (in the comic series) is stated to be from a small village called Witxeldorf. Obviously German.
Funnily enough, at first he was regected by DC. *cough* Dumass much!
For some history: a gypsy woman claimed to have found his mother and father dead and Kurt to be an abandoned infant shortly after he was born, but later when that was questioned it turned out to be that his mother was MISTIQUE....

 This lady,,, aka Raven Darkholme...

And his father to be a demonic warlord.

From what i know:
When Wolverine escaped weapon X the idea of a mutant killing machine didn't follow. Thus, scientists used his DNA to create a female clone, born by Doctor Kinney of their department.

As you can see here: Wolverine. X23. They're pretty alike.
 She was raised, and i'm guessing she was pretty much treated like an animal. Forced into killing, alot, and alsorts. Her mother was weak from my veiw, and the only thing she ever did for her "daughter" was read her stories; such as pinochio (she isn't a real girl, so that kinda does have a point to it.)
Turned out that when wolvie escaped weapon x, he killed basically everyone: including the scientist "Dale Rice". Decades later Rice's son Zander picked up where his dad left off. Their main plan: Clone wolverine and use his clone as an assassin for hire.But. There is always that but... their genetic material was damaged, the Scientist Sarah Kinney could only salvage the X Chromosone, so she created a female clone.
The 23rd embryo was viable and Sarah was put into serving as the surrogate mother for the project: "X23".
The clone grew up in the facility and was dehumanized to keep her from gainig a sense of self. A the age of seven she was put into martial arts training. Soon after weapon X developed a trigger sense inside her that would go off and send her into a crazy killing spree. She developed claws in her hands, but unlike wolverine the middle one is on her feet. The facility coated them in admantium. Zander hated wolverine and took it out on X23. he developed, what the timeline in the bacl of X23 vol. 1 calls "An indesrtuctable sadist" called Kimura, who punished X for any mistake. Including the tiny ones. X began to cut herself, but naturally her healing factor fixed over this.
Her combat and spy training intensified and her first mission was taken out with ease as she assassinated the presidential candidate Greg Johnson by posing as a disabled child.
For 3 years X killed targets all over the world. She had no emotion. No moral, or feelings towards right and wrong. She was like a machine, basically. She became one of King Pins Fav. assassins. But on a mission oposing AIM's lab Zander left her behind, and the AIM troops nearly killed her. When she finally did make it back, Zander lied and KImura punished her (agaaaaiiinnn). Sarah learnt that her neice was missing and got X to help her find her by breking her out. Zander was PISSED.
Zander gave her a few more missions of his own accord, her mother was horrified. They found out that Zander had begun Gestantion of the embryo's X24 and X50. Her mother gave her a final mission: destroy Zander and the embryo's.
X beat the living crap out of her lifelong tormenter...anf BADLY. She left him for dead. Then blew up the lab. But Zander had planted a trigger sense in Sarah. When X came out of her berserker rage her mother was bleeding in the snow: but she finally gave X a real name... Laura.
X went to live with Sarah's neice, who she had previously helped: Megan, and her mother Debbie, but Debbies boyfreind was a facility spy. He dosed her tea with trigger sense, and spilt it. She killed him.
Kimura showed up to their house and X sent Megan and Debbie away with fake ID's. Then she saught Wolverine out and they fought until she calmed down. Then captian America showed up and arrested her for multiple murders. He soon realized she was just another victim and let her go.
She was lost on the street and working for a pimp "Zebra daddy", doing tricks for guys whho liked to be cut. Then one (John) killed himself, she was blamed, ran with a group of others and killed everyone including Zebra daddy who came after her.
X killed some gangsters after a freind of hers and go dumped in Xmen's custody, though she desperatly needed social work.
After M day Wolverine convinced her to come back to the Xmen, but she scared most of the remaining students. Hellion and Miss Frost were particularily mean and Frost wanted her gone. But when it came to deciding on the new Xmen Cyclops maded sure she made the cut.

Featured in this New Xmen volume.
Reverend Stryker bombed the school kiling 42 former mutants and saved her roomate Dust, then also prooved that the sentinel NImrod was with Stryker. X was badly injured so Hellion got her to Elixir the healer. She started to develop a crush on hellion. 
Things went along from time to time mission to mission with the Xmen. (She joined Xforce as well but Wolverine changed his mind at the end of the crisis when Hope returned so she could be herself and make her own decisions. )
At one later poitn the facility recaptured X and Kimura cut off her arm. BUt later he berserker rage was triggered and she killed everyone, except Kimura who got away. Her arm grew back and she had her admantium replanted.
Currently X is inher own series, Beggining with "X23: the kiling dream" as she goes about her "life". Note this first comic is where all my facts are coming from.
Power notes: X has hightened healing (possibly better than wolverine because she had oftern said to him "you heal too slow", Acrobatics, Admantium enlaced CLAWS so skeleton unknown if it was really done like wolverines, She is freakishly well trained, thorough, merciless, and has her trigger sense.
